Work where you matter.** **A Brief Overview** Accountable for providing direct, personal care and services to residents in the skilled nursing facility, which meet the physical, academical, social and spiritual needs on a daily basis to maintain and improve their highest level of independent function. **What you will do ** * Provides assistance to residents with their activities of daily living * Performs routine duties and non-routine duties as directed by nursing staff. This may include but not limited to assisting patients with bathing and dressing needs, shaving, oral hygiene, bed making, transfers into and out of bed, repositioning, toileting needs, serving and collecting food trays, encouraging and/or assisting with feeding, answering call lights, insuring a clean environment, transporting patients upon admission and dismissal, assisting with ambulation and orienting/reorienting of resident to the facility environment to insure resident safety. * Performs blood pressure, pulse, temperature, respiration and weight. Documents concise and factual information on the appropriate forms. * Performs or assists residents in performing specific medical care activities in accordance with established policy and procedure to contribute to the patient's plan of care. This includes assisting residents in performing restorative exercises, collecting specimens as directed by nursing staff. Assessing and documenting completed cares. Provide feedback to nursing staff immediately on status or changes in patient conditions,
